Embark on a high-flying adventure with a captivating five-minute documentary that shines a spotlight on the C-141 Starlifter, a legendary aircraft that played a pivotal role in global air mobility for over four decades. Introduced during the 1960s, the Starlifter was the U.S. Air Force’s first jet-powered heavy-lift transport, revolutionizing strategic airlift capabilities with its impressive range and payload capacity. With thrilling archival footage and insights from aviation experts, uncover the remarkable engineering feats behind its design—such as its high-wing configuration and clamshell rear doors, which facilitated rapid cargo loading. Discover the diverse missions undertaken by this versatile workhorse, from humanitarian aid and disaster relief to crucial roles in military operations spanning the Vietnam War to Desert Storm. Hear firsthand accounts from pilots and crew who fondly remember the Starlifter as a symbol of reliability and innovation.
